On Sep 13, 2009, at 1:15 PM, Andy Koppe wrote:

> 2009/9/13 Philip Semanchuk:
>> I also ran 'uname -srv' didn't contain anything
>> that looked like a relevant version number.
>
> uname -r normally does the job:
>
> $ uname -r
> 1.7.0(0.212/5/3)
>
> Unfortunately that doesn't contain the package release number used to
> differentiate the beta releases, which is why each beta release
> announcement contains this little tidbit:
>
>> FAQ:
>> ====
>>
>> - Q: How do I know that I'm running Cygwin 1.7.0-61?
>>
>>  A: The `uname -v' command prints "2009-09-11 01:25"

Thanks Andy. Mine is dated 2009-08-20 10:56; I'm sure that's well past  
the 1.7.0-29 release which is the one I'm concerned with.
